milamber5
Bonjour,
ça fait un moment que ce problème me pourrit mon computer...
Lorsque je lance une application du genre up2date (ça le fait aussi avec system-config-packages) j'obtiens une horreur (du genre cf. plus bas). Je pense qu'il faudrait mettre à jour une variable d'environnement, mais laquelle ?
# up2date
Traceback (most recent call last):
File "/usr/sbin/up2date", line 33, in ?
from up2date_client import up2date
File "/usr/share/rhn/up2date_client/up2date.py", line 32, in ?
import depSolver
File "/usr/share/rhn/up2date_client/depSolver.py", line 11, in ?
import packageList
File "/usr/share/rhn/up2date_client/packageList.py", line 20, in ?
import up2dateComps
File "/usr/share/rhn/up2date_client/up2dateComps.py", line 9, in ?
from rhpl import comps
File "/usr/lib/python2.4/site-packages/rhpl/comps.py", line 5, in ?
import libxml2
File "/usr/lib/python2.4/site-packages/libxml2.py", line 1, in ?
import libxml2mod
ImportError: /usr/lib/python2.4/site-packages/libxml2mod.so: undefined symbol: xmlDictCleanup
# system-install-packages
Traceback (most recent call last):
File "/usr/share/system-config-packages/SinglePackageWindow.py", line 24, in ?
import method
File "/usr/share/system-config-packages/method.py", line 15, in ?
import GroupSet
File "/usr/share/system-config-packages/GroupSet.py", line 26, in ?
import rhpl.comps
File "/usr/lib/python2.4/site-packages/rhpl/comps.py", line 5, in ?
import libxml2
File "/usr/lib/python2.4/site-packages/libxml2.py", line 1, in ?
import libxml2mod
ImportError: /usr/lib/python2.4/site-packages/libxml2mod.so: undefined symbol: xmlDictCleanup
kiki
Cela ressemble plus à un problème python, plutôt qu'une variable qu'il ne trouve pas. C'est à dire qu'il ne trouve pas les modules dont il a besoin.
Je pense qu'une petite mise à jour par yum (ou apt) pour se faire consulter le tutorial d'herrib sur YUM. Ce qui est valable pour FC3 reste valable pour la version 4. Il n'est pas utile de passer par up2date et l'outil system-config-packages, ne te servira à rien si tu utilises YUM.
[supprimé]
yep sir... Le problème c'est que voici ce que j'obtiens lorsque je fais un :
# yum update
The yum libraries do not seem to be availableon your system for this version of python 2.4.1 (#1, May 16 2005, 15:19:29)
[GCC 4.0.0 20050512 (Red Hat 4.0.0-5)]
Please make sure the package you used to installyum was built for your install of python.
Aaaargh... Mon python c'est tout ça :
# rpm -qa|grep python
python-elementtree-1.2.6-4
gnome-python2-gtkhtml2-2.10.0-2.1
gnome-python2-canvas-2.10.0-1
dbus-python-0.33-3
libxml2-python-2.6.19-1
gnome-python2-gnomevfs-2.10.0-1
gnome-python2-extras-2.10.0-2.1
python-urlgrabber-2.9.6-1
python-sqlite-1.1.6-1
gnome-python2-2.10.0-1
gnome-python2-gconf-2.10.0-1
rpm-python-4.4.1-21
gnome-python2-bonobo-2.10.0-1
python-devel-2.4.1-2
python-2.4.1-2
Ce sont tous les trucs installés par FC4 automatiquement...
kiki
Le résultat de ta commande t'informe que les librairies de yum ne sont pas en accord avec la version de python installé sur ta machine.
Ce que je peux te conseiller comme tu n'as plus l'outil yum c'est de le réinstaller à partir des CD, ou bien de le télécharger puis de l'installer!
Je n'ai pas ma FC4 sous la main, donc je ne peux pas voir quelle version de python ni de yum j'ai d'installé, mais je me demande si la version 2.4.1 de python n'est pas la version de test...